Price for Yarn; of Jute or of Other Textile Bast Fibres, Single in Bahrain (CIF) - 2022
The average import price for yarn; of jute or of other textile bast fibres, singles stood at $1,569 per ton in 2022, dropping by -12% against the previous year. In general, the import price recorded a abrupt contraction.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2019 when the average import price increased by 125% against the previous year. Over the period under review, average import prices hit record highs at $3,997 per ton in 2016; however, from 2017 to 2022, import prices remained at a lower figure.
Average prices varied somewhat amongst the major supplying countries. In 2022,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was China ($1,927 per ton), while the price for India stood at $1,516 per ton.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by the UK (+36.1%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ced a decline.
Imports of Yarn; of Jute or of Other Textile Bast Fibres, Single in Bahrain
In 2022, supplies from abroad of yarn; of jute or of other textile bast fibres, singles decreased by -41.5% to 429 kg, falling for the second year in a row after two years of growth. In general, imports, however, recorded a significant incre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2020 with an increase of 506% against the previous year. As a result, imports attained the peak of 1.3 tons. From 2021 to 2022, the growth of imports of remained at a somewhat lower figure.
In value terms, imports of yarn; of jute or of other textile bast fibres, singles reduced notably to $673 in 2022. Over the period under review, imports, however, enjoyed noticeable growth.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2020 when imports increased by 334%. As a result, imports attained the peak of $2.5K. From 2021 to 2022, the growth of imports of failed to regain momentum.
